Vole removal services involve identifying and eliminating voles from residential properties to prevent damage and restore yard health. These small, burrowing rodents can cause extensive underground tunnels that compromise lawns, gardens, and landscaping features. Professional service providers use a combination of trapping, baiting, and habitat modification techniques to effectively reduce vole populations. The goal is to address infestations discreetly and efficiently, helping homeowners protect their outdoor spaces from further harm.
Voles are known for creating extensive tunnel systems just beneath the surface of lawns and gardens, which can lead to damaged roots, uneven ground, and dead patches in grass. They often invade properties with lush vegetation, making vegetable gardens, flower beds, and turf vulnerable to destruction. These pests can also attract predators or other unwanted wildlife, creating additional concerns for homeowners. Properties that frequently seek vole removal services include residential yards, farms, and landscaped commercial properties. Homes with dense ground cover, thick grass, or abundant shrubbery are particularly susceptible to vole activity. Gardens with vegetable patches or ornamental plantings are also common sites for infestations. Homeowners who notice signs of vole activity-such as small mounds of dirt, chewed plant stems, or irregular patches of dead grass-may benefit from professional removal services. These signs often indicate active tunnels and ongoing damage beneath the surface. The overview below groups typical Vole Removal proj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Kenosha, WI.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or vole removal services in Kenosha and nearby areas range from $250 to $600. Many routine jobs fall within this middle range, covering common nuisance situations. Fewer projects reach the higher end of this spectrum unless additional repairs are needed.
Moderate Projects - For more extensive vole control efforts or partial property treatments, costs generally range from $600 to $1,200. These projects often involve larger areas or multiple visits, which local contractors handle regularly within this band.
Full Property Treatments - Complete vole removal for larger properties or heavily infested areas can cost between $1,200 and $2,500. Such projects are less common but are handled by experienced local service providers for comprehensive control.
Complete Exclusions or Repairs - Larger, more complex projects involving structural repairs or full exclusion systems can reach $5,000 or more. These are typically reserved for extensive damage or high-value properties, with fewer jobs falling into this highest cost range.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are the signs of vole infestation? Signs include small, round holes in lawns, tunneling under the grass, and chewed plant roots or bulbs in Kenosha, WI area yards.
How do local contractors typically remove voles? They often use trapping methods or habitat modification to control vole populations around homes and gardens.
Are there preventive measures to keep voles away? Yes, contractors may recommend removing ground cover, installing barriers, and reducing food sources to deter voles from settling nearby.
